Detail of GEF Project #2648
| GEF Project ID | 2648 |
| Funding Source | GEF Trust Fund |
| Project Name | Capacity Building for the Implementation of the National Biosafety Framework |
| Country | Tunisia |
| Region | Africa |
| Focal Area | Biodiversity |
| Operational Program | 1; 2; 3; 4; 13 |
| Approval Date | 2006-02-08 |
| GEF Agency Approval Date | 2007-01-22 |
| Project Completion Date | 2011-06-01 |
| Project Status | Under Implementation |
| GEF Agency | UNEP |
| Executing Agency | Ministry of Agriculture, Environment and Water Resources |
| Description | The overall objective of the project is to implement in Tunisia, by 2008, a workable, responsive and transparent NBF, in line with the national development priorities, the Cartagena Protocol and other international obligations. The project will provide the necessary financial and technical assistance to: - Transform Tunisian National Biosafety Framework to a legally binding national biosafety regulatory regime through the enactment of Laws, and drafting of implementing regulations, decrees, orders; - Prepare specific training guides and manuals; - Train decision makers, scientists, administrative and technical staff on legal, scientific and technical matters;· - Enhance existing institutional facilities and infrastructures to undertake GMO detection and monitoring activities;· - Set up a mechanism for monitoring of enforcement; -·Strengthen channels for communication and information dissemination nationally, as well as through the Biosafety Clearing House (BCH);· - Promote public awareness and participation |
